Great game with a fantastic atmosphere. The game is frustrating at first if you think you're supposed to build and expand the borders of your kingdom.

I survived 100 days on the third island and the strategy that I found that worked is to only build walls outside the siege shop and the scythe shop and clear as many trees as possible on both sides to spawn rabbits. If you build a wall farther away then no rabbits will spawn behind the wall which is a big waste of rabbit spawns. Also your soldiers take longer to get from one side of your town to the other.

Don't build towers unless you are making the bakers shop. Towers are useless and the man at the top of the tower can easily be taken by floaters. The path to victory is to keep hiring as many vagrants as possible everyday so you keep increasing your damage per second against the increasing number of greed.

If trying to survive for 100 days you must have the baker and there needs to be an archer shrine in the level. If there is no archer shrine then just leave that island as soon as you can.

Winter never ended for me and I relied only the bank. I managed to store hundreds of coins there prior to winter coming. By day 15 just rely on getting coins from rabbits and around then I had destroyed the portals on the dock side and then I could setup farms (at least 12) on that side. I think around day 15 the rabbits stop spawning or the spawn rate drops so you will need the farms to keep gathering gold until winter comes.

During winter your mount can barely sprint because there is no grass to eat so you must have the baker to win. Don't bother with the 100 days challenge unless you have the baker.

When destroying portals, send your knights immediately after the blood moon night ends. Greed don't spawn the next night so that gives enough time for your knights to reach the portal.

An interesting game where you goal really is to gather as much gold and vagrants as possible.

Excellent software for drawing pixel art and creating animated pixel art. I've used it extensively for two of my games here on Steam and I'm happy with what I can achieve with Aseprite.

A really well made game. I finished it in 3 hours and I found it a lot of fun. If you like resource management games then you'll find this one to be fun. The graphics are pleasant, the sounds are nice, it is polished and bug free. It doesn't have much replay value but that doesn't matter. I enjoy a well crafted experience over sandbox type games because they are so much more memorable and I can now move onto another game satisfied that I completed this one and enjoyed it.
